As it has been explained on numerous occasions already, Bitcoin market cap as well as the whole cryptomarket cap is meaningless and useless for comparison with assets of a different nature. In simple terms, you are trying to compare incomparable things just because they happen to be measured in the same dollars and seemingly represent the same thing. But they are not even if it is the same dollars (though these are not the same dollars anyway).
Simply put, cryptomarket cap is fake as it doesn't reflect real number of coins traded. Technically, to get a correct assessment of the cryptomarket cap you should take into account only the coins that actually get traded or circulated. If you were able to do that (you can't), you would quickly find out that the figure thus obtained would be a tiny fraction of what you are being led to believe as Bitcoin or any other coin market cap.
